Being a landlord comes with its own set of challenges and responsibilities. One of the most difficult situations landlords may find themselves in is having to evict a tenant. Evicting a tenant can be a complex and time-consuming process that requires a thorough understanding of landlord-tenant laws. This is where an eviction solicitor can be invaluable.

An eviction solicitor is a legal professional who specializes in landlord-tenant law and eviction proceedings. They can provide landlords with the legal expertise and guidance they need to navigate the eviction process successfully. Whether you are a first-time landlord or have been in the business for years, having an eviction solicitor on your side can make all the difference in ensuring that your rights are protected and that the eviction process is conducted in a fair and lawful manner.

One of the primary reasons why landlords choose to hire an eviction solicitor is to ensure that they are following the correct legal procedures when evicting a tenant. Eviction laws can vary significantly from state to state, and it can be challenging for landlords to navigate the complex legal requirements on their own. An experienced eviction solicitor will have a thorough understanding of the laws governing evictions in your area and can ensure that all of the necessary steps are taken to evict a tenant lawfully.

In addition to helping landlords navigate the legal intricacies of the eviction process, an eviction solicitor can also handle all communication with the tenant on your behalf. This can be particularly helpful in cases where the relationship between the landlord and tenant has broken down, and communication has become difficult. An eviction solicitor can act as a mediator between the two parties, helping to facilitate a smooth and amicable resolution to the eviction process.

Another benefit of hiring an eviction solicitor is that they can help landlords avoid costly mistakes that could delay the eviction process or result in legal disputes. For example, failing to provide proper notice to a tenant before initiating eviction proceedings can result in the case being thrown out of court. An eviction solicitor will ensure that all legal requirements are met and that the eviction process proceeds smoothly and efficiently.

Furthermore, an eviction solicitor can also represent landlords in court if the eviction case goes to trial. Having legal representation in court can be essential in ensuring that your rights as a landlord are protected and that the eviction process is conducted fairly. An experienced eviction solicitor will be able to present evidence and arguments effectively in court, helping to secure a favorable outcome for the landlord.
